    Unboxing and Initial Setup: Getting Started with Your Roomba Combo 10 Max

    So, you've got your shiny new Roomba Combo 10 Max! Exciting, right? The unboxing experience is pretty straightforward. Inside the box, you'll find the robot itself, a charging station, a power cord, and some documentation. First things first: place the charging station against a wall, ensuring it has enough space on either side and in front for the robot to dock properly. Plug it in, and let's get the Roomba Combo 10 Max charging. While it's charging, download the iRobot app on your smartphone or tablet. The app is your command center, allowing you to control the robot, schedule cleaning sessions, and customize settings. The app will guide you through the setup process, which typically involves connecting the robot to your Wi-Fi network. Make sure your Wi-Fi is strong enough to reach all the areas you want the robot to clean. Once the robot is connected and fully charged, you're ready to roll! Before its first cleaning, I recommend giving your floors a quick once-over to remove any large debris that could potentially get stuck.     Key Features and Functionality: What Makes the Roomba Combo 10 Max Stand Out

    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ty. What makes the Roomba Combo 10 Max worth its salt? Well, it packs a punch with some impressive features. This robot is designed to both vacuum and mop, hence the "Combo" in its name. It's equipped with a powerful suction system that effectively picks up dirt, dust, and debris from various floor types, including carpets and hard floors. The innovative feature is the auto-retracting mop pad. When the Roomba Combo 10 Max encounters carpet, the mop pad lifts itself, preventing the carpet from getting wet. This is a huge advantage over some other combo robots. The Roomba Combo 10 Max uses iRobot's advanced navigation technology. It intelligently maps your home, creating efficient cleaning paths. This means it methodically cleans your floors without bumping into furniture or getting stuck. You can create virtual boundaries within the app to tell the robot which areas to avoid, which is great for protecting delicate items or preventing it from going into areas you don't want cleaned. The Roomba Combo 10 Max also features voice assistant compatibility, so you can start, stop, and schedule cleaning with just your voice using devices like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ant. The Roomba Combo 10 Max has a self-emptying dustbin, a fantastic feature that minimizes the need to manually empty the robot after each cleaning session. It automatically empties the robot's dustbin into a larger bag inside the Clean Base. This is a massive time-saver.     Maintenance and Care: Keeping Your Roomba Combo 10 Max in Tip-Top Shape

    Like any appliance, the Roomba Combo 10 Max needs a little TLC to keep it running smoothly. Regular maintenance ensures optimal performance and extends the lifespan of your robot. Here are some key maintenance tasks to keep in mind. First off, empty the dustbin after each cleaning session. If you have the Clean Base, you'll need to replace the bag in the Clean Base every few months, depending on your usage. Clean the brushes regularly to remove any hair or debris that might get tangled. The Roomba Combo 10 Max has a main brush roll and side brushes that need periodic cleaning. Inspect and clean the front and rear wheels to remove any tangled hair or debris that might impede the robot's movement. Also, clean the mopping pad after each use. Remove it, rinse it under running water, and let it air dry before reattaching it. Replace the mopping pad every few months, depending on usage. Check the filters regularly and replace them as needed. The filters capture fine dust particles, and they need to be replaced to maintain optimal suction power. Regularly wipe down the sensors and charging contacts to remove dust and debris that could affect performance.     Troubleshooting Common Issues: What to Do When Things Go Wrong

    Even the best robots can encounter hiccups from time to time. Here's how to troubleshoot some common issues with the Roomba Combo 10 Max. If your robot is not charging, check the power cord and charging station connections. Make sure they are securely plugged in. Ensure there's no debris obstructing the charging contacts on the robot and the charging station. If the robot is not cleaning effectively, check the brushes and filters. Clean or replace them as needed. Check the suction opening for any clogs. Make sure the dustbin is not full. If the robot is getting stuck, check for obstacles like cords, rugs with tassels, or items left on the floor. Use the virtual wall feature in the app to prevent the robot from entering restricted areas. If the robot is not connecting to your Wi-Fi, ensure your Wi-Fi network is active and within range. Restart the robot and your router. Re-enter your Wi-Fi password in the iRobot app. If the robot is making unusual noises, inspect the brushes, wheels, and suction opening for debris. Clean or remove any obstructions. If the robot is not responding to app commands, try restarting the app or the robot. Ensure the robot is connected to your Wi-Fi network. If all else fails, consult the iRobot support website or contact customer service for further assistance.
